Vietnam’s 2026-27 V-League season begins on Sept. 4 with 14 teams, a larger foreign-player allowance and expected prominence for diaspora players. Công An Nhân Dân FC targets promotion, while league coverage examines Vietnam’s standing in Southeast Asian football.
CAND FC launches new season with promotion to V-League as its target
Công An Nhân Dân FC has opened its campaign for the 2026-27 professional season with a clear objective: win Vietnam’s national first division and secure promotion to the V-League. The Ministry of Public Security held the launch ceremony on September 3.
